The Sheikh CEO addresses the leadership style His Highness Sheikh Mohammed Bin Rashid Al Maktoum advocates for considering his prestigious role as the Vice President and Prime Minister of the UAE, and Ruler of Dubai.

The book is written by Dr Yasar Jarrar, who is considered as one amongst the closest confidants of the Sheikh. Additionally, Dr Jarrar holds a non-resident research fellowship at MBRSG (Mohammed bin Rashid School of Government) and holds the role as a strategic advisor in the Middle East in the PwC Middle East Government Consulting Group.

The substantial rise of Dubai is intriguing to many, making the insight the Sheikh has conferred in the book to be of great value. The book is primarily about the leadership style the Sheikh implores as opposed to it being about Dubai.

The book explores thematic matters of resilience, dedication, innovation, perseverance, and a will to sustain for future leaders.

Dr Yasar Jarrar wrote The Sheikh CEO based on his firsthand experience working for the Executive Office and interviews with people who worked—and continue to work—with His Highness.

The structure of the book follows six captivating chapters that end with lessons in leadership.

The titles of the chapters are as followed: The Rise of Dubai Inc., Lead with courage and vision, Action trumps everything, Never believe that your work is complete, Surround yourself with strong leaders, and Win hearts and minds.

Finally, it concludes with an epilogue: ‘We shall go to Mars’, which is very fitting as today marks the day after the launch of the remarkable UAE Hope Probe to Mars making it the world’s first Mars mission.
